Revenue expenditure is the short term expenses required to meet an ongoing operational need in the business. In another word, that expenditure which is incurred in connection with the operation and administration of daily activities of the business is called revenue expenditure. Benefits of revenue expire within a year. Expenditure of revenue is shown on a debit side of the trading and profit and loss accounts.Revenue expenses include repairs and regular maintenance as well as repainting and renewal expenses of available assets too. Revenue expenditure incurred in acquiring raw materials for manufacturing process or finished goods for resale.
